Monday 27th July
Mark confronts Faye and asserts that she and Ryan aren't wanted in the village. Faye stands firm telling him she's not going anywhere, but she's intrigued when he warns her to stay away from Cain. Later that day, she approaches Cain and asks him to reconsider taking Ryan on at the garage and Ryan's thrilled when Cain offers him the job, while Mark watches on uneasy at their growing closeness.

In the Woolpack, Cain hints to Faye that they might see more of each other now that he's working with Ryan, but Faye makes it clear she's wise to him and using Ryan to win her over isn't going to work. Cain's excited by the challenge and can't help smiling as Faye leaves. Meanwhile, Mark has witnessed their exchange and is unnerved to think Faye is toying with him.
Determined to keep Rodney and Diane apart, Val jumps in when Diane asks him to cover Masie's shift in the pub, claiming she's already asked Pollard to help out. Pollard is less than impressed with his new role behind the bar and snaps when Lily and Lisa take delight in being awkward customers and ordering their old boss around. Val's irked when her plan backfires and Diane decides to take Rodney up on his offer of dinner - seeing as Eric is in control behind the bar.
However, at Rodney's, Diane feels uncomfortable when his reminiscing takes a romantic turn. What are Rodney's intentions?
Tuesday 28th July
Mark approaches Ryan in the cafe and tries to persuade him to leave the village with Faye but when Mark warns that he'll get her out of the village one way or another, Ryan's furious. Faye watches in the distance as Ryan squares up to him and warns him to stay away from his mother. Alone with Ryan, Faye questions his run in with Mark and she's angry when he tells her it's time she moved on from Mark. Will Ryan get to the bottom of the real reason Faye wanted to move to Emmerdale?
Meanwhile, Val is still convinced something is going on between Diane and Rodney and her suspicions are fuelled when Diane receives a bunch of flowers from him, thanking her for a lovely evening. Amused, Diane laughs her off, insisting he's just a mate, but it's clear she's feeling uneasy at Rodney's gesture.
When Rodney arrives in the pub later that day, Diane tells him he doesn't stand a chance but is mortified when Rodney tells her he simply wanted to say thank you for her support after the accident and she's got the wrong end of the stick. However, when Val spots Diane give him a friendly peck on the cheek she's sure it's confirmation that they're more than friends and is determined to put an end to it. How far will Val go?
Wednesday 29th July
Determined to stop Rodney getting back together with Diane, Val puts her plan into action dolling herself up to go and seduce Rodney.
He's bemused by her provocative attire and is stunned when she reveals she's still in love with him. As Val pursues Rodney extolling her feelings for him, he struggles to get away and rejects her advances telling her to control herself! However, when Val lies that Pollard isn't satisfying her needs and hints she's his for the taking, he finally relents to a kiss. Val pulls away triumphant that she's proved he's not serious about Diane. Rodney's baffled and tells her he and Diane have already decided they can never be more than friends.
Val's flummoxed and tries to defend her actions claiming she was trying to protect her sister, but Rodney's furious and threatens to let everyone know that she just cheated on her husband to try and ruin her sister's happiness. Val's horrified as Rodney kicks her out telling her she's gone too far this time, has she sacrificed her marriage and her relationship with Diane?
Faye is perplexed when she receives the keys to a brand new car through her letter box. Ryan suggests it's a bribe from Mark, but when she confronts him about it he angrily asserts it's nothing to do with him although he'd buy her a fleet of cars if it'll encourage her to leave! Cain finally lets her know that he bought the car as a moving in present but she's unimpressed by his grand gesture and tells him she's not that easily bought, before dropping the keys at his feet.
Thursday 30th July
Val is relieved that Rodney hasn't told Pollard about her attempt to seduce him, but she's on edge knowing she made a fool of herself and wondering how to repair the damage. She begs Rodney not to tell anyone but he refuses to hear her out. Diane is intrigued as she witnesses the altercation between the pair and drags them into the back room to get to the bottom of what's going on.
As Val tries to explain her logic and justify coming onto Rodney, Pollard is covering the bar and keeping one ear open as he tries to listen in on the raised voices in the backroom. Val apologises for her mistake, sure they can forget about it and move on, but Diane is incredulous. Unaware that Pollard has entered the room, she lays into Val telling her she can't keep messing with people's lives, she asks whether Val even thought about Pollard before she tarted herself around. Dumbstruck Pollard demands to know what is going on. Will he forgive his wife's indiscretion?
As Pollard waits for someone to tell him what's going on, Val is devastated and unable to face up to him, she runs out of the pub. A confused Pollard bangs on the door to the cottage demanding she let him in, while inside a tearful Val struggles to figure out what to do. Feeling terrible about what she's putting him through, she finally confronts him, but is shattered when he reacts very badly to her confession and tells her to pack her things and leave.
Realising how her actions have hurt and humiliated Pollard, Val is on the warpath after Diane. However, Diane refuses to be held responsible, insisting Val's her own worst enemy and after a blazing row with her sister, Diane reveals she's had enough of the drama and she wants her out of her life and out of the pub. Has Val lost her husband, sister, home and business in one day?
Meanwhile, at their consultation Lexi and Carl are informed that there's a long wait for IVF and the alternative is too expensive. Lexi is gutted and tells Carl how useless she feels not being able to conceive. Carl feels terrible seeing how much it means to her, but still doesn't commit to paying for the treatment. Will Lexi let her dream of being a mother slip away that easily?
Friday 31st July
Lexi tells sceptical Nicola and Scarlett that they've decided to postpone the IVF treatment. She's touched but refuses Scarlett's offer to pay for the treatment with her trust fund. Meanwhile, Carl is getting increasingly frustrated with Nicola and snaps when she challenges him about not being able to afford the IVF.
Desperate, Lexi asks Diane if she has any jobs going in the kitchen and is upset when Carl criticises her desperation. Later that day, she tells Scarlett she'd like to take her up on her offer and when they excitedly reveal the news to Carl, he's privately gutted that he's now forced to go ahead with it. Will he come clean to Lexi?
